Therefore, the total number of protons … Web20 jul. 2024 · RIKEN Physicists in Japan have blasted out the heaviest calcium nuclei ever seen—each containing the 20 protons needed to make the element, but with a huge number—40—of neutrons. That's twice as many neutrons as in calcium's most common form, and a couple more than the previous record. imdb anne hathaway
